Compressor Sizing
• A compressor is sized based on two pieces of information, boost pressure and airflow.
• The desired boost pressure is chosen based on the performance objectives.
• The minimum boost pressure needed to achieve the performance objectives is to be evaluated.
• The airflow is directly related to the engine speed and is thus calculated based on what part of the speed range is desired to experience a power increase.
• Once the boost pressure and airflow are known, they are used to size the compressor.
• A compressor works best at a particular combination of airflow and boost pressure.
A comparison of this optimal combination of boost
pressure and airflow for a given compressor to the
Engine anticipated combination of boost pressure and airflow
determines the suitability of the compressor for the
system.
